Title :
Performance analysis of global concurrency control algorithms and deadlock resolution strategies in multidatabase systems
Author :
Moon, Aekyung ; Cho, Haengrae
Author_Institution :
Dept. of Comput. Eng., Yeungnam Univ., Kyongbuk, South Korea
Abstract :
Even though many global concurrency control (GCC) algorithms have been proposed to ensure global serializability, their performance is not well understood. We address the GCC problem from the performance perspective, and evaluate the performance of several GCC algorithms using a multidatabase simulation model. We also evaluate the performance of alternative deadlock resolution strategies, and analyze its implication with regard to the degree of supporting local autonomy. The simulation results of this study, the first of its kind in the area of multidatabase systems, make it possible to select an appropriate GCC algorithm and a deadlock resolution strategy for a given heterogeneous distributed environment
Keywords :
concurrency control; database theory; distributed algorithms; distributed databases; software performance evaluation; transaction processing; virtual machines; GCC problem; deadlock resolution strategies; global concurrency control algorithms; global serializability; heterogeneous distributed environment; local autonomy; multidatabase systems; performance analysis; simulation model; transaction processing; Algorithm design and analysis; Concurrency control; Concurrent computing; Control systems; Database systems; Distributed databases; Moon; Performance analysis; Protocols; System recovery;
Conference_Titel :
Communications, Computers and Signal Processing, 1997. 10 Years PACRIM 1987-1997 - Networking the Pacific Rim. 1997 IEEE Pacific Rim Conference on
Conference_Location :
Victoria, BC
Print_ISBN :
0-7803-3905-3
DOI :
10.1109/PACRIM.1997.620347